#f7bd64 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f7bd64 is composed of 96.9% red, 74.1%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 23.5% magenta, 59.5%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 36.3 degrees, a saturation of 90.2% and a lightness of 68%. #f7bd64 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c8 with #ef7b00.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c66.

#f7bd64 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f7bd64 has RGB values of R:247, G:189, B:100 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.23, Y:0.6,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 16235876.

Shades and Tints of #f7bd64
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0801 is the darkest color, while #fffdf9 is the lightest one.
